Transaction 15175119bb00374102f4bf843e7f4b08cfc59dcfd8b4415c84b2b9ffa096d94c
1 Input
1 Output
-
15175119bb00374102f4bf843e7f4b08cfc59dcfd8b4415c84b2b9ffa096d94c:0
- value
- 29566112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d430c9c14485d3f6fb88ad8ec7d12afcd4a4089b OP_EQUAL
- address
- 3M2yd4webu3XYowXTyrrM9671kNLPprAPu